Of all of the quarterbacks having a down season so far, Brady supposedly among them, here is my list of the most underachieving quarterbacks in order...

1. Russell Wilson
He looks completely befuddled on literally every passing down... what the hell happened to this guy? Had an excellent career in Seattle, and although he started showing some slippage last season, what we're seeing right now is a precipitous decline. With a massive contract too.

2. Matthew Stafford
8 INTs, 11 turnovers so far... he's playing like the bad version of Brett Favre. No repeat for the Rams with Stafford stinking up the joint.

3. Aaron Rodgers
Almost gave away the game to the Patriots who were down to their 3rd string QB. Followed that up with back to back home losses to the NY teams. Hasn't surpassed 255 passing yards and is playing totally uninspired football. Looks like a case of take the money and run.

4. Mac Jones
Yes Jonesy you make the list. 14 turnovers in your last 8 games with a 2-6 record...

5. Kyler Murray
Another quarterback with a new mega contract hangover. Maybe the return of Hopkins will get him straightened out but Murray has been garbage so far. Only 6 TDs to go along with 4 INTs... and people are on Brady's case for 8 TDs and 1 INT... all of these QBs would be thankful for that right now.

Dishonorable mentions....

Matt Ryan... 8 TDs & 7 INTs... bring back Wentz who took an entire season to reach 7 INTs.
Justin Fields... doesn't have much around him but he looks like a complete bust.
Moral of the story looking at the top 3 here: if your name is not Mahomes or Allen and your QB is getting 40mil plus, they're grossly overpaid.
